Miu Garden has been around for many years and it's a good place to go for a decent Cantonese meal without breaking the bank.  Very popular for dim sum since their prices are quite low, but my review is based on dinner.  We had a set meal for 4 ($35.99) that included a steamed fish and steam chicken plus 2 dishes of your choice from a list of about 30.  There are many other set meals but we liked this one because of the extra variety.  Dishes were quite good and the fish was done well.  Our other 2 dishes were the pepper and salt pork chops and a baby bok choy topped with mushroom and conpoy dish.  The pork was spicy and crisp and the vegetables were saucy...maybe a little too saucy for my liking but still good.  I can't really comment on "wok hay" for this meal, but in the past, sometimes it was a little lacking.  However, I can't complain at this price point.  If you don't like their set meals, you can order a la carte and most dishes are still under $10.  They usually offer a few specials during dinner, like fried stuffed crab claws, (the ones at banquets) they were on special for $1.99 each.  Meals come with complimentary house soup and dessert (2 options were available, the typical red bean dessert soup and tofu "fa").  We got the tofu "fa" and I liked the hint of ginger in it.  Service was friendly and there was enough staff to meet our needs.

Wide range of dim sum choices, all-Asian clientele. Miu Garden is a popular resto inside the Market Village, northeast of the Pacific Mall, heart of the Asian shopping district in Markham.

My father (a retiree who seems to have dim sum too often) suggested that we celebrate my mother's birthday there. We arrived before noon on a Sunday, and the restaurant was filled. My father had camped out in a small room at the back that would be appropriate for private parties.

Miu Garden seems to offer a broader range of dishes that the normal dim sum. Seaweed salad would be more expected in a Japanese restaurant, the rice noodle around the fried bread stick (as opposed to pork, shrimp or beef) was a nice change. The normal dishes (e.g. siu mai, spare ribs, sticky rice) were freshly made, and the portions seemed larger than usual. The congee was unusally flavourful.

For seven of us, the bill turned out to be less than $10 each. I've heard that English isn't a strong suit for the restaurant, but when the food comes around on carts, who cares?

The entrance to the restaurant is interior to the mall, across from the food court. If the parking on the west side of the building (facing the Pacific Mall) is too chaotic, try the east side of building, where there's a long awning leading into the mall.
